National Arts Festival celebrates 50 years of national creativity

JOHANNESBURG - This year, South Africa’s longest-running and most diverse arts festival turns 50.

The festival, which takes place annually in Makhanda, Eastern Cape, is a global gathering place for artists and art enthusiasts.

It provides an opportunity for up-and-coming artists to showcase their work.

This year’s festival runs from the 20 to 30 June.

The Festival is still a mainstay of South Africa's cultural calendar, and this year's edition looks to be one of the most vibrant and inclusive to date.

Attendees are to anticipate performances by renowned South African and international artists in the visual, performing, and dance arts.

The lineup has a colourful mash-up of avant-garde and experimental performances that challenge the conventions of traditional art genres.

About 200 concerts from South Africa and throughout the globe will be featured at the event.

It will mark the third physical contact festival after being held virtually for two years due to Covid-19.
